Very Strange Soundtrack
Though not great, by any means, this film was rather interesting. I didn't really know much about Linda beforehand, and I feel like I learned a few factual things about her from this film.
To correct another poster (possibly on another thread), the film mentions Linda's vegetarianism at least twice, and in one of her pleas to Paul, she makes a comment about supporting animals' rights. The film cannot explore everything, and truthfully, the title is slightly inappropriate. It really is a love story, but it is Linda and Paul's. The film focusses on them almost equally within the context of their relationship. It really isn't a Linda biopic.
That said, I found the soundtrack very odd. The songs from the era were all okay. It is strange, however, that the music of Wings is almost completely absent. It is similarly strange that songs from the early Beatles' career (certainly pre-Linda) were very prominent. Did anybody hear any music from Sgt. Peppers? In that respect, if you are not old enough to have been there, or don't have the background in Beatles music, you might not recognize that the songs are all pretty anachronistic when paired with the events shown in the film.
